Definition
noun
(Greek mythology) one of three sisters who were the givers of beauty and charm; a favorite subject for sculptors
noun
(Christian theology) a state of sanctification by God; the state of one who is under such divine influence
Example:
"the conception of grace developed alongside the conception of sin"
noun
elegance and beauty of movement or expression
Example:
"a beautiful figure which she used in subtle movements of unparalleled grace"
noun
a sense of propriety and consideration for others
Example:
"a place where the company of others must be accepted with good grace"
noun
a disposition to kindness and compassion
Example:
"the victor's grace in treating the vanquished"
noun
a period of time past the deadline for fulfilling an obligation during which a penalty that would be imposed for being late is waived, especially an extended period granted as a special favor
Example:
"The payment had originally been due on April 1 but we had a grace period which expired in June."
